Ubuntu Security Notice USN-7703-2
August 20, 2025
linux-aws-6.8, linux-gcp, linux-gcp-6.8, linux-gkeop, linux-ibm,
linux-ibm-6.8 vulnerabilities
==========================================================================
A security issue affects these releases of Ubuntu and its derivatives:
- Ubuntu 24.04 LTS
- Ubuntu 22.04 LTS
Summary:
Several security issues were fixed in the Linux kernel.
Software Description:
- linux-gcp: Linux kernel for Google Cloud Platform (GCP) systems
- linux-gkeop: Linux kernel for Google Container Engine (GKE) systems
- linux-ibm: Linux kernel for IBM cloud systems
- linux-aws-6.8: Linux kernel for Amazon Web Services (AWS) systems
- linux-gcp-6.8: Linux kernel for Google Cloud Platform (GCP) systems
- linux-ibm-6.8: Linux kernel for IBM cloud systems
Details:
Several security issues were discovered in the Linux kernel.
An attacker could possibly use these to compromise the system.

After a standard system update you need to reboot your computer to make
all the necessary changes.
ATTENTION: Due to an unavoidable ABI change the kernel updates have
been given a new version number, which requires you to recompile and
reinstall all third party kernel modules you might have installed.
Unless you manually uninstalled the standard kernel metapackages
(e.g. linux-generic, linux-generic-lts-RELEASE, linux-virtual,
linux-powerpc), a standard system upgrade will automatically perform
this as well.
